We are seeking a dedicated and experienced Administrative Services Team Lead (Job File Coordinator) Team Lead to join our team in Midlothian VA. This position is responsible for managing a team of Job File Coordinators ensuring efficient and smooth workflows. Our idea of the ultimate candidate is one who is proactive experienced truly enjoys providing exceptional customer service able to take ownership and work in a fast-paced environment. This position works to ensure processes are performed according to SERVPRO Franchise guidelines with completed jobs meeting or exceeding customer expectations while also seeking way to improve team performance.
Responsibilities:
- Monitor assigned job files to include monitoring status audit and work-in-progress
- Assist in scheduling Project Manager to complete jobs
- Provide timely resolution of customer questions and concerns
- Assist with after-hour questions technical support and handling customer calls as needed
- Train new hires and provide continued training sessions for performance improvement
Requirements:
- 5 years of office accounting or customer service experience
- 1 year of management or supervisory experience required
- Experience with performing performance reviews for team members & providing job training
- Strong organizational and planning skills with exceptional attention to detail
- Exceptional written and verbal communication skills
-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ite
- Experience in data management & process development
- Drivers license in good standing
